Selective leaf surface defenses: trichomes trap herbivorous leafminers but spare parasitoid wasps. [PDF]
Hooked trichomes on kidney bean leaves selectively entrap leafminer flies but rarely affect parasitoid wasps. This morphological barrier enables pest suppression with minimal impact on beneficial insects, offering insights for breeding pest‐resistant cultivars compatible with biological control. Influence of Leaf Nitrogen on Leafminer Damage and Yield of Spray Chrysanthemum
Abstract Damage by leafminer [Liriomyza trifolii (Burgess)], increased linearly as leaf nitrogen increased from 2.2% to 4.0% in spring and fall plantings of Chrysanthemum x morifolium Ramat. ‘Manatee Yellow Iceberg’. The number of marketable stems was related quadratically to leaf nitrogen with maximum yields estimated to occur at 3.6% at harvest.
